Job Description

Twist is seeking a Visual Designer to join our internal creative team. You’ll be a key contributor to Twist’s creative approach to branding, campaigns, content, events and more. The right candidate will work closely with our wider marketing team to create inventive conceptual, visual and messaging solutions, based on briefs, that simplify complex scientific products and processes, then translate them into compelling consumer-facing collateral. This will include digital ads, print ads, presentations, social media, sales promotions, outdoor advertising, ebooks, event design and collateral, web page designs, swag designs and much more. Twist takes pride in the creativity and inventiveness of our brand, design and messaging–we’re looking for talent that can not only continue this tradition, but take it to the next level.

What You’ll Do

  • Create compelling design concepts, illustrations, icons, data visualizations and artwork.
  • Contribute to the visual identity and branding of Twist and our products.
  • Participate in briefing and brainstorming sessions. 
  • Revise your work based on feedback from collaborators.
  • Build compelling decks that explain your ideas, then help present them to peers and leadership persuasively.
  • Contribute to design projects with minimal oversight, delivering projects on time and to the highest standards. Collaborate positively with key stakeholders, project management, and company leadership.
  • Mentor team members, fostering growth and development. Contribute dynamically to Twist’s creative standards and approach.
  • Use digital management and asset tools like Frontify and Airtable to keep projects on track.
  • Bring new creative and marketing  inspiration to the team and company. Advocate for creative and design excellence internally.
  • Understand and advocate for the Twist brand and our customers.
  • Educate yourself on our products, market, competitors, and customers. While it’s not necessary to hold a scientific degree or training, deep curiosity and passion for science, scientists and technology is a must.

Who You Are

  • A creative thinker and maker with 5 or more years of proven experience in marketing design, advertising, or branding, with an online portfolio showcasing your work.
  • Expertise in design, typography, photography, illustration, and color.
  • Able to understand, align to, and creatively evolve brand guidelines.
  • Proficient in the Adobe Creative Suite, in particular, InDesign, Photoshop, Illustratrator.. Familiar with Google Suite and MS Office Suite. Familiar with best practices in design production. Comfort with Figma.
  • Passionate about design, creativity, branding and advertising.
  • Able to work on multiple projects at once. Conscientious about deadlines, process and communication.
  • A team player who works well with cross-functional teams.
  • Open to feedback, willing to think innovatively and collaboratively to solve problems.
  • Able to work resourcefully and inventively when faced with some ambiguity, tight budgets, and tight timelines.

Nice to haves

  • Motion graphic, video editing and animation experience.
  • Experience working with digital asset management and project management software.
  • Previous experience working with technology or biotech brands.

About Twist Bioscience

Twist Bioscience synthesizes genes from scratch, known as “writing” DNA. Just as children learn to both read and write, the next phase of development for the genomics revolution is the ability to write DNA.

At Twist Bioscience, we work in service of people who are changing the world for the better. In fields such as health care, agriculture, industrial chemicals and data storage, our unique silicon-based DNA Synthesis Platform provides precision at a scale that is otherwise unavailable to our customers.
